Remember the Vulcan Jet engine??

Stripped the whole thing down. Then had various parts blasted with soda, walnut shells and sand followed by a serious amount of polishing all the components. 85% of it is made of titanium. The combustion chamber took me a week to polish alone. All new aircraft-grade nuts and bolts have been used throughout - and there's a lot of them!!!!

Still in the process of reassembling it - lots of fuel lines have yet to go back on but I'm well pleased with the way it's coming along.

Last thing to do is the stand. I've drawn up the design so just needs my mate to engineer it.

What's it going to be? A floor standing up-lighter :thumbright:

My mate will spin up a reflector that'll sit inside the 'nozzle'. Add bulb and job jobbed!
